All counseling forms will be maintained with the student's records. Additionally, the school commandant or designated ...The counseling form may be typed or handwritten in blue or black ink. If a form is not available, plain bond paper may be used. The rater is responsible for writing the content of the counseling. The counseling should take place in a private setting with only the Counselor and the Soldier present. During the ORI on 31 May 07, at shift change, you were told by SSG Smith that we would comply with Mopp 4 requirements at Bravo Site whether anyone came out to inspect us or not and you acknowledged his direction.We would like to show you a description here but the site won’t allow us.The counseling is captured on the Department of Army (DA) Form 4856. The Soldier can add comments on the second page of DA Form 4856. The Soldier cannot be forced to sign or comment on DA Form 4856. However, if you disagree with the counseling, you should sign and add your comments. The Key Points of Discussion block is the main section of the counseling form. The behavior or event that made counseling necessary must be fully described here. Since room is limited, try to be as brief as possible while including all the details that matter and are most important.We're working on a mobile solution. In order to counsel someone for a bad attitude, the counselor must be specific and focus on actions rather than attitude. Write down specific verbal and physical behaviors and actions that affect others, hurt team morale, or damage productivity. Also record nonverbal behaviors, such as eye rolling, clenching fists, or ...the leader's facts and observations prior to the counseling.) If you refuse to sign, the counseling statement can still be used.One way to view these terms is through their relationship in time. Mentoring looks at the future and at potential; coaching looks at the present and how to improve to a future state and is more skill focused; and counseling looks at the past and how to improve for the future. Counseling is part of coaching, and coaching is part of mentoring.DA Form 4856 Army Counseling Form AUG 2010 Back to DA Forms Menu The Army released a new counseling form in August of 2010. Strictly enforce the standards, from haircuts and uniforms to proper military courtesy.Counseling for Soldiers is normally recorded on DA Form 4856 but other formats are allowed for the initial counseling. NCOs (E-5 and above) should receive counseling quarterly unless their conduct requires it more frequently. NCO counseling is normally documented on DA Form 2166-8-1 but other formats are allowed for the initial counseling.Saddled with student loans and unable to find work that will pay even the most basic bills, Devon turned to the Army.
